Deprecated: The each() function is deprecated. This message will be suppressed on further calls in /home/zhenxiangba/zhenxiangba.com/public_html/phproxy-improved-master/index.php on line 456
[B! .NET] imai78のブックマーク
[go: Go Back, main page]

タグ

.NETに関するimai78のブックマーク (24)

  • .NETでもGemに似た仕組みを·NU MOONGIFT

    NUはRuby製/.NET用のオープンソース・ソフトウェア。各プログラミング言語にはライブラリ管理を行う仕組みが用意されている。PerlではCPAN、RubyではRubyGems、PHPではPear、Pythonではeasy_installといった具合だ。 インストールはgemコマンドで .NETについては詳しくはないのだが、同様の仕組みはないのかも知れない。.NET自体はオープンソースではなくとも周辺ライブラリではオープンソースなものも増えている。そうしたライブラリを手軽に使えるようにするのがNUだ。 NUがユニークなのはRubyGemsを使ってインストールを行う点だろう。「gem install nu」と打つとインストールされる。つまり.NET向けでありながらRuby(またはIronRuby)必須だ。インストールが終わったら次からは「nu」コマンドを使って操作する。 NUnitをインス

    .NETでもGemに似た仕組みを·NU MOONGIFT
    imai78
    imai78 2010/08/20
    .NET向けでありながらRuby必須とはw
  • DOBON.NETプログラミング道 - DOBON.NET

    DOBON.NET プログラミング道「DOBON.NET プログラミング道」では、まだまだプログラミング勉強中の私「どぼん!」が、Microsoft .NET Framework、VB.NET、C#、Visual Basic、Visual Studio、インストーラなどについて調査、研究した結果を発表させていただいています。 .NET Framework研究.NET プログラミング Tips.NET Frameworkプログラミング(主に Visual Basic .NET と C#)で役に立ちそうな小技を、ソースコードとサンプルを交えて紹介。 メールマガジン「.NETプログラミング研究」.NET FrameworkプログラミングのTipsやFAQなどをメールマガジンでお届け。 DoboWikiASP.NET無料ホスティング紹介ASP.NETが使える完全無料のホスティングサービスに関する情

  • DOBON.NET: VB.NET, C#,

    DOBON.NET へようこそ!DOBON.NET では、プログラミングに関する様々な情報を提供しています。少しでも皆様のお役に立てれば、幸いです。 プログラミング.NET TipsMicrosoft .NET Framework(C#、VB.NET、Visual Studioなど)を使用したプログラミング、アプリケーション開発に関する情報、解説、Tips、ソースコード、サンプル等の紹介。 フォームコントロールDataGridDataGridViewファイル・フォルダ文字列・暗号化画像・印刷インターネットシステムプロセス基セットアップ...すべて見るその他無料ソフト検索掲示板更新履歴DoboWikiリンク集リンクをご希望の方へカードゲーム「ドボン」

  • .NET から COM(例:BASP21) を使う - おのれ鍋奉行が!

    Imports BASP21Lib Partial Class _Default Inherits System.Web.UI.Page Protected Sub Page_Load(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Load Dim obj_basp21 As Basp21 = New Basp21() Response.Write(obj_basp21.Version()) End Sub End Class

    .NET から COM(例:BASP21) を使う - おのれ鍋奉行が!
  • @IT:ASP→ASP.NET移行テクニック

    ≪今回の内容≫ ・移行の3つのアプローチ ・<統合>移行パターンの類型化 ・どの移行方式を選択するべきか? ・構造上の変更点 いまさら声を大にしていうまでもなく、ASP.NETは大変優れたアーキテクチャだ。かつてWindowsサーバにおける標準的なサーバ・サイド技術であった旧来のASP(以降、「レガシーASP」と呼ぶ)もまた優れた技術であったが、末期にはさまざまな問題点が指摘されていた。ASP.NETは、レガシーASPで指摘されていた問題点に対するMicrosoft社の解答であり、次世代アーキテクチャへの試みであるといえる。 開発生産性、パフォーマンス、スケーラビリティ、セキュリティなどなど……、ASP.NETがもたらす効果については、すでに多くの記事が解説しているので、ここでは繰り返さない。詳細については、別稿「プログラミングASP.NET」や「ASP.NETで学ぶVisual Stud

  • Chapter18 LINQ to XML(1/7) - @IT

    同書籍は、もともとフォーラムにて連載していた『C# 2.0入門』、『C# 3.0入門』の記事を整理統合し、加筆、修正されたものです。 手元でまとめて読みたい方は、ぜひ書店などにてお買い求めください。 【注意】記事は、書籍の内容を改変することなく、そのまま転載したものです。このため用字用語の統一ルールなどは@ITのそれとは一致しません。あらかじめご了承ください。 18.1 LINQプロバイダーを導入する別の理由 前章では、クエリを遠隔地のサーバーに依頼するためにLINQ to Objectsではなく、カスタムなLINQプロバイダーを使用する価値があることを示した。しかし、それはLINQプロバイダーを使用する理由のすべてではない。別の意図で作成されるLINQプロバイダーもある。 たとえば、「LINQ to XML」はXML文書に対する検索を依頼するLINQプロバイダーであるが、これは遠隔地

  • Part2 これがWindows Vistaだ!

    Microsoft Windowsの最新版である「Windows Vista」は,どのようなOSでしょうか。OSの基機能を紹介した「Part1 今さら聞けないOSの疑問」に続くPart2では,最新Windowsの実態をプログラマ向けに明らかにします(注:記事内容は2006年中旬時点の情報に基づいています)。 Windows Vistaは,高速な検索,より強固なセキュリティ対策,RSS(Really Simple Syndication)を扱うAPI,新しいInternet Explorerなど,数多くの新機能が搭載され,Windows XPとはかなり違った印象のOSです。 数ある新機能の中で,プログラマに最も関係が深いのは,新しいアプリケーション開発/実行環境である「.NET Framework 3.0」です。開発段階では,既存のWin32 APIを置き換える新しいAPI(開発コード名:

    Part2 これがWindows Vistaだ!
  • 現場開発者から見たVisual Studio 2010(1/3) - @IT

    特集:Visual Studio 2010(ベータ2)で効率的な開発を! 現場開発者から見たVisual Studio 2010 WINGSプロジェクト りばてぃ(著) 山田 祥寛(監修) 2010/01/19 2010年を迎え、次期Visual Studio 2010(以下、VS 2010)のリリースも目前まで迫ってきた。@ITをはじめ、各メディアでは特集が組まれているので、それらの内容からすでにVS 2010の新機能に関する情報を得ている諸氏も多いだろう。稿では少し基に立ち返って、従来からある機能などにもフォーカスしながら、開発者にとって便利なVS 2010という視点で解説する。 ■VS 2010の概要 VS 2010は2010年前半のリリース(米国でのローンチは2010年4月12日)を目標に開発が進められている.NET Frameworkのための新しい統合開発環境(IDE)である

    imai78
    imai78 2010/01/20
    「ブレークポイントに条件設定」は良いな!
  • Silverlight 4登場、そして2010年 | gihyo.jp

    現在 現在、Silverlight3が正式版として昨年の7月10日に公開されています。Silverlight3ではブラウザ外で実行できるOut of Browser機能やH264、AACなどのコーデックのサポートをはじめ、様々な機能が追加されアプリケーションを格的に開発できる環境が整いました。 さらに、一息つく間もなく11月18日の約4カ月後には米国で開かれたPDC09でSilverlight4がアナウンスされBeta版が利用可能になりました。 稿ではSilverlight4 Betaの印象的な機能を紹介し、最後に現在までの振り返りと今後の筆者の期待を込めた展望を記載します。 Silverlight 4 Betaの開発環境 Silverlight4 Betaは既に開発者向けランタイムが配布されており、従来通りのSilverlight Toolsも公開されています。Silverlight

    Silverlight 4登場、そして2010年 | gihyo.jp
  • 第1回 「.NET開発者中心」コーナー開設アンケート結果(2009年9月実施)(1/3) - @IT

    .NET開発者中心 読者調査レポート 第1回 「.NET開発者中心」コーナー開設アンケート結果(2009年9月実施) デジタルアドバンテージ 一色 政彦 2009/11/24 「.NET開発者中心」は、2009年9月10日(木曜日)よりオープンした、@IT/Insider.NETのサブコーナーである。前身であるVB研(VB業務アプリケーション開発研究室)のコンテンツを踏襲しつつ、新たにC#言語などのほかの言語も取り入れた、より実践や実務に根差した実用的な記事展開を目指している。さらに、業務アプリケーション開発者同士が相互扶助して高めあっていける場(=Hub)となることを目標にしている。 その新コーナー開設を記念して、2009年9月10日(木)~9月24日(木)の期間、Windows/.NET ベースの業務アプリケーション開発に携る@IT読者を対象に、Web上での自記式アンケートによる読者調

  • Visual Studio 2010 Beta 2を使ってみよう

    はじめに Microsoftは2009年10月19日、次期アプリケーション開発プラットフォーム「Visual Studio 2010」および次期アプリケーション・プラットフォーム「.NET Framework 4」のベータ2版の提供を開始し、11月には日語版の一般公開も開始されました。稿では、「Visual Studio 2010」ベータ2版(日語)の新機能について前・後編の2回に分けて取り上げます。前編ではインストールから主にIDEでの強化点について、後編ではSilverlightツールのVisual Studioでの使用方法やWindows 7での開発、ADO.NET Entity Frameworkについて取り上げる予定です。 また、稿の内容はベータ段階であるため、実際の製品提供時とは機能が異なる場合があります。なお、こちらの記事によると、2010年3月22日に公式な製品のラ

    Visual Studio 2010 Beta 2を使ってみよう
    imai78
    imai78 2009/11/25
    azureとの連携部分はともかく、それ以外はどんどんEclipseになっていくイメージ。
  • APPENDIX 1 高機能・直感的で安心して使えるアプリケーションの解「Microsoft Visual Studio」 | gihyo.jp

    アジャイル トランスペアレンシー ~アジャイル開発における透明性の確保について~ APPENDIX 1 高機能・直感的で安心して使えるアプリケーションの解「Microsoft Visual Studio」 日々進化する IT は高機能、直感的で使いやすい、安心して使用できるアプリケーションの登場を促しています。マイクロソフトが提供する Visual Studio は、マーケットニーズに応えるために自信を持って送り出す製品です。 みなさんは“⁠アジャイル⁠”と聞いてどんなことを連想されるでしょうか―「小規模チーム」「⁠多くのチェック ポイントがあり、変化が多い」「⁠何でも変えてしまえる、緩い開発の方法論」…… アジャイルとは、「⁠素早い」や「機敏」という意味合いを持ち、スポーツ選手の反応の速さを表現する時などに使われる単語です。それだけに、アジャイルな開発とは、いかなる事態においても機敏に反

    APPENDIX 1 高機能・直感的で安心して使えるアプリケーションの解「Microsoft Visual Studio」 | gihyo.jp
    imai78
    imai78 2009/11/20
    .NETは滝モデル、というイメージだったけどもう違うんだね。
  • ASP.NET MVCのセキュリティ対策とクライアントサイドスクリプト活用方法

    はじめに ASP.NET MVCはASP.NET 3.5ベースですので、ASP.NET MVC固有のセキュリティ対策や、スクリプトの利用についても基的に意識する部分は少ないです。 しかし、フレームワークとしてどのような対策が行われているか気になる方も多いかと思います。今回はASP.NET MVCが提供しているセキュリティ対策と、ASP.NET MVCアプリケーション上でASP.NET AJAX Control Toolkit(以下、Control Toolkit)を利用する際のコツを紹介します。 必要な環境 次の環境が必要です。 Visual Studio 2008 SP1 ASP.NET MVC RTW版 ASP.NET AJAX Control Toolkit(Scriptファイルのみ) Visual Studio 2008(以下、VS2008)のインストールはVisual Stud

    ASP.NET MVCのセキュリティ対策とクライアントサイドスクリプト活用方法
  • MySpace、MapReduceフレームワーク「MySpace Qizmt」をオープンソースで公開 | gihyo.jp

    濃縮還元オレンジニュース MySpace⁠⁠、MapReduceフレームワーク「MySpace Qizmt」をオープンソースで公開 2009年9月16日、MySpaceは.NETプラットフォーム上で動作する分散処理フレームワーク「MySpace Qizmt」をGoogle Code上に公開しました。 MySpace Qizmtの分散処理部分はGoogleMapReduceに基づいて設計されています。オープンソースのMapReduce実装としてはJavaで書かれた「Hadoop」が有名ですが、MySpace QizmtはC#で書かれており、WIndowsサーバ上で稼働することが特徴的です。MySpace自体が数千台のWindows 2003サーバ上で動いていることから、このようなフレームワークが.NETで作られていることもうなずけます。ジョブを記述するにあたってデバッガが付いた専用のエディ

    MySpace、MapReduceフレームワーク「MySpace Qizmt」をオープンソースで公開 | gihyo.jp
  • C#とIronPythonで変化に強いWindowsアプリケーションを作る

    2006年9月、.NETで動作するPython「IronPython」が正式にリリースされました。.NET環境の格的な動的言語として多くの注目を集めている反面、C#やVisual Basicを使っている開発者にとって、IronPythonの魅力が良くわからないという人もいるのではないでしょうか。そこで、稿では、C#からIronPythonを利用するメリットとその方法について紹介します。 はじめに 2006年9月、.NETで動作するPython「IronPython」が正式にリリースされました。.NET環境の格的な動的言語ということもあってIronPythonは多くの注目を集めました。その反面、C#やVisual Basicを使っている開発者にとって、IronPythonをどのような局面で使ってよいのかわからない人も少なくないと思います。また、IronPythonの魅力がわからない人も

    C#とIronPythonで変化に強いWindowsアプリケーションを作る
  • 「ASP.NET Web Form」か「ASP.NET MVC」か? .NETによるWebアプリ開発の今を徹底討論

    CodeZine編集部では、現場で活躍するデベロッパーをスターにするためのカンファレンス「Developers Summit」や、エンジニアの生きざまをブーストするためのイベント「Developers Boost」など、さまざまなカンファレンスを企画・運営しています。

    「ASP.NET Web Form」か「ASP.NET MVC」か? .NETによるWebアプリ開発の今を徹底討論
  • OPC Diary: Linq to XML 入門 その4 結合(JOIN)その2

  • C#でiPhone開発!MonoTouch Beta ファーストインプレッション - backyard of 伊勢的新常識

    iPhoneの開発はXcodeでObjective-C。そんな常識が打ち破られる時が来ました。 もともとVisualStudioヘビーユーザーだった僕としてはXcodeはまだまだ補完機能がしょぼくて当にやりたいことができるまで定義定義の嵐でやきもきして途中でやる気がなくなってしまいます。 そうこうしているうちにMonoTouchというライブラリが発表されました。.NETのオープンソース実装をしているMonoプロジェクトの外郭として開発された、.NETを使用してiPhone開発をできるようにしたライブラリです。 .NETは中間言語をJITコンパイルする技術なのですが、言語処理系をiPhone上に実装すると規約違反となり、AppStoreで販売できません。そこで、MonoTouchでは先に全部コンパイルしてしまいます。*1 Monoの名前を冠していますが、(Novellから?*2 )製品とし

    C#でiPhone開発!MonoTouch Beta ファーストインプレッション - backyard of 伊勢的新常識
  • J#のライブラリを使ってZIP圧縮、展開(解凍)、リスト表示を行う

    J#のライブラリを使ってZIP圧縮、展開(解凍)、リスト表示を行うここでは、J#のライブラリであるvjslib.dllを使用して、C#やVB.NETZIP書庫の作成(圧縮)、展開(解凍)、閲覧を行う方法を紹介します。 なお、.NET FrameworkでZIP書庫を扱う方法は、これ以外にも、以下の記事で説明しているような方法もあります。 ZipFile、ZipArchiveクラスを使用して、ZIP圧縮、展開(解凍)、リスト表示などを行う#ziplib(SharpZipLib)を使ってZIP圧縮、展開(解凍)、リスト表示などを行う遅延バインディングによりアンマネージDLL関数を呼び出すDotNetZip(Ionic Zip Library)を使ってZIP書庫を作成する - DoboWikiはじめにC#、VB.NETには一般的なZip書庫を扱う方法が用意されていませんが、J#にはvjslib

    J#のライブラリを使ってZIP圧縮、展開(解凍)、リスト表示を行う
  • C# vs VB.NET

    C# vs VB.NET~.NET雑感~ 戻る ■ 導入 さて、私も送ればせながら、この前 Visual Studio .NET というものを買ってみました。 使ってみて、非常に使いやすいツールだと思いますし、おそらくは今後、この.NETがWindowsの標準になっていくのでしょう。(※1) さて、.NETを買ってみると、おもに3つの言語が入っています。 それが、VB.NET、C#、マネージC++の3つです。 他にもJ#やASP.NETが入っていますが、これはJAVA経験者やサーバプログラミングをする人のためのものですので、 とりあえず重要なのは、この3つの言語です。 ■ Which? ここで、1つ疑問が湧いてくると思います。 それは、どの言語を使うべきかという事です。 もちろん、VB6を使っていた人はVBを使えばよいわけですし、C言語を使ってきた人は、C#を使えば良いわけです。(※2)